Calgary, Canada, February 13: Home prices in Calgary and Victoria registered a record decline in the months of November and December.

This was revealed by the latest figures of Statistics Canada.
However, the price rise is expected in the coming times making the housing market make a modest recovery. This will happen in the wake of increased demand and less supply of houses and will get boost by low rates of Canada house loans. The New Housing Price Index increased 0.4 percent in the month of November and December, as was estimated.
Calgary also offers the right mix of what an immigrant from Asia looks for before moving to Canada. IN fact most Immigrant consultants or attorneys advise clients of moving to Calgary as one of the potential destination.
A senior market analyst in Calgary for CMHC (Canada Mortgage and Housing Corp.), Richard Cho, stated that there is a clear evidence of increased demand for housing as the economy of the country progresses towards betterment resulting in increased Canada house investments.
Statistics Canada stated that there were monthly decline of 0.2 percent in the new housing price index of Victoria and Calgary which was in strong contrast to the rise in the new home prices by 0.4 percent(on monthly basis).
Meanwhile, the index for the country saw a drop in the last 12 months by 0.9 percent.
Calgary saw the third highest drop in the new house prices at 3.1 percent, while Victoria’s house prices went down by 8.2 percent.
Nationally, Edmonton’s house prices fell by 9.4 percent between December 2008 and December 2009.
With lower-priced houses, several Calgary builders were initiated to new development projects, the federal agency of Calgary’s price change in the month of December.
Quebec saw the biggest year-over-year price rise at 6.9 percent.
The figures for new house market statistics revealed by the CMHC for the Calgary census metropolitan area revealed that apart from 116 new semi-detached dwellings which fetched $350,987(on an average), $358,198 were received from sales of 33 apartment in the month of November 2009. The average price for the month of November for 521 new single-detached house sales was $474,405.
In January 2010, a decline of five percent was registered(as compared with the month of December) in the homes sales when 762 single family homes were sold, while the sale of condominiums was 376, an increase of 10 percent from the month of December 2009.
